Decentralizing Intelligence: The Rise of Edge AI Solutions

The landscape of artificial intelligence is dramatically, with a growing shift towards edge computing. This paradigm allows the deployment of sophisticated algorithms directly on devices at the edge of the network, rather than relying on centralized cloud infrastructure. This transformation offers a range of benefits, such as reduced latency, improved privacy, and enhanced robustness in applications where real-time analysis is crucial.

Edge AI solutions are continuously emerging across diverse industries, from robotics to connected devices and manufacturing. By pushing intelligence closer to the data, these solutions enable a new generation of interactive systems that can evolve in real-time, interacting intelligently to dynamic circumstances.
